# Runbook: Hunting leaked file descriptors in Quillgate

When the `fd_open` gauge climbs steadily between deploys, suspect a leak rather than load. First confirm on a single pod: exec in and count entries under `/proc/1/fd`, noting how many are sockets in CLOSE_WAIT versus regular files. Capture two snapshots ten minutes apart before restarting anything — we need the delta for the postmortem. Reproduce locally with the Marbury load harness, which requires the service running with the following configuration values.

settings of yagep-bajog:
[istdor]
port = 4000
region = south-2
host = istdor.qorvelcorp.internal
timeout_ms = 5000
retries = 5

Finance Review Summary — Training Budget, Next Fiscal Year

Prepared for the heads of department. The proposed training allocation rises eight percent, driven mainly by the Larkspur certification program and expanded onboarding at the Dunmere site. Travel-linked training is trimmed in favor of facilitated remote cohorts. Department caps remain unchanged pending the December review. Please weigh your requests against the strategic direction noted confidentially below.

confidential, tagep-yahag: Headcount on the Oliael team goes from 5 to 100 by the end of July. Gross margin on Oliael came in at 20 percent against a plan of 15 percent.

## SQL Lint Failures

If the Brindle pipeline blocks a merge on SQL lint, do not disable the check. Rules are enforced by sqlgate on every file under /queries. Most failures are casing or missing semicolons; run sqlgate --fix locally first. Escalate to the Datagrove channel only if the rule itself seems wrong. The linter reads its ruleset at startup, and the active configuration is as follows.

deployment values, bagag-bawig:
DRUVAN_PIN=0740
DRUVAN_TENANT=wendor
DRUVAN_METRICS_HOST=metrics.druvan.tolvaqnet.example
DRUVAN_SEAL=seal_75cd0b2d
DRUVAN_STANDBY_TEAM=tamael